AdGroupBidModifier

Đại diện cho hệ số sửa đổi giá thầu cho nhóm quảng cáo.

Biểu diễn dưới dạng JSON
{
  "resourceName": string,
  "bidModifierSource": enum (BidModifierSource),
  "adGroup": string,
  "criterionId": string,
  "bidModifier": number,
  "baseAdGroup": string,

  // Union field criterion can be only one of the following:
  "hotelDateSelectionType": {
    object (HotelDateSelectionTypeInfo)
  },
  "hotelAdvanceBookingWindow": {
    object (HotelAdvanceBookingWindowInfo)
  },
  "hotelLengthOfStay": {
    object (HotelLengthOfStayInfo)
  },
  "hotelCheckInDay": {
    object (HotelCheckInDayInfo)
  },
  "device": {
    object (DeviceInfo)
  },
  "hotelCheckInDateRange": {
    object (HotelCheckInDateRangeInfo)
  }
  // End of list of possible types for union field criterion.
}
Trường
resourceName

string

Bất biến. Tên tài nguyên của hệ số sửa đổi giá thầu cho nhóm quảng cáo. Tên tài nguyên hệ số sửa đổi giá thầu của nhóm quảng cáo có dạng như sau:

customers/{customerId}/adGroupBidModifiers/{adGroupId}~{criterionId}

bidModifierSource

enum (BidModifierSource)

Chỉ có đầu ra. Nguồn của hệ số điều chỉnh giá thầu.

adGroup

string

Bất biến. Nhóm quảng cáo có chứa tiêu chí này.

criterionId

string (int64 format)

Chỉ có đầu ra. Mã của tiêu chí để sửa đổi giá thầu.

Trường này bị bỏ qua đối với các trường hợp thay đổi.

bidModifier

number

Công cụ sửa đổi cho giá thầu khi tiêu chí phù hợp. Công cụ sửa đổi phải nằm trong khoảng: 0,1 – 10,0. Phạm vi là từ 1.0 - 6.0 cho PreferredContent. Sử dụng số 0 để chọn không tham gia một Loại thiết bị.

baseAdGroup

string

Chỉ có đầu ra. Nhóm quảng cáo cơ sở mà từ đó hệ số sửa đổi giá thầu nhóm quảng cáo dự thảo/thử nghiệm này được tạo. Nếu adGroup là nhóm quảng cáo cơ sở thì trường này sẽ bằng adGroup. Nếu nhóm quảng cáo được tạo trong bản nháp hoặc thử nghiệm và không có nhóm quảng cáo cơ sở tương ứng, thì trường này sẽ rỗng. Trường này ở chế độ chỉ đọc.

Trường kết hợp criterion. Tiêu chí của hệ số sửa đổi giá thầu nhóm quảng cáo này.

Bắt buộc trong các thao tác tạo bắt đầu từ phiên bản 5. criterion chỉ có thể là một trong những trạng thái sau đây:

hotelDateSelectionType

object (HotelDateSelectionTypeInfo)

Bất biến. Tiêu chí lựa chọn ngày đặt khách sạn (ngày mặc định so với ngày do người dùng chọn).

hotelAdvanceBookingWindow

object (HotelAdvanceBookingWindowInfo)

Bất biến. Tiêu chí cho số ngày trước khi lưu trú được đặt phòng.

hotelLengthOfStay

object (HotelLengthOfStayInfo)

Bất biến. Tiêu chí cho thời gian lưu trú tại khách sạn theo đêm.

hotelCheckInDay

object (HotelCheckInDayInfo)

Bất biến. Tiêu chí cho ngày trong tuần mà cần đặt trước.

device

object (DeviceInfo)

Bất biến. Tiêu chí thiết bị.

hotelCheckInDateRange

object (HotelCheckInDateRangeInfo)

Bất biến. Tiêu chí cho phạm vi ngày nhận phòng khách sạn.

BidModifierSource

Enum mô tả các nguồn có thể sử dụng hệ số điều chỉnh giá thầu.

Enum
UNSPECIFIED Chưa chỉ định.
UNKNOWN Chỉ dùng cho giá trị trả về. Biểu thị giá trị không xác định trong phiên bản này.
CAMPAIGN Hệ số điều chỉnh giá thầu được chỉ định ở cấp chiến dịch, theo tiêu chí ở cấp chiến dịch.
AD_GROUP Hệ số sửa đổi giá thầu được chỉ định (bị ghi đè) ở cấp nhóm quảng cáo.

HotelDateSelectionTypeInfo

Tiêu chí lựa chọn ngày đặt khách sạn (ngày mặc định so với ngày do người dùng chọn).

Biểu diễn dưới dạng JSON
{
  "type": enum (HotelDateSelectionType)
}
Trường
type

enum (HotelDateSelectionType)

Loại lựa chọn ngày đặt khách sạn

HotelAdvanceBookingWindowInfo

Tiêu chí cho số ngày trước khi lưu trú được đặt phòng.

Biểu diễn dưới dạng JSON
{
  "minDays": string,
  "maxDays": string
}
Trường
minDays

string (int64 format)

Mức thấp nhất của số ngày trước khi lưu trú.

maxDays

string (int64 format)

Giá trị cao nhất của số ngày trước khi lưu trú.

HotelLengthOfStayInfo

Tiêu chí cho thời gian lưu trú tại khách sạn theo đêm.

Biểu diễn dưới dạng JSON
{
  "minNights": string,
  "maxNights": string
}
Trường
minNights

string (int64 format)

Mức thấp của số đêm lưu trú.

maxNights

string (int64 format)

Mức cao nhất về số đêm lưu trú.

HotelCheckInDayInfo

Tiêu chí cho ngày trong tuần mà cần đặt trước.

Biểu diễn dưới dạng JSON
{
  "dayOfWeek": enum (DayOfWeek)
}
Trường
dayOfWeek

enum (DayOfWeek)

Ngày trong tuần.

HotelCheckInDateRangeInfo

Tiêu chí cho phạm vi ngày nhận phòng.

Biểu diễn dưới dạng JSON
{
  "startDate": string,
  "endDate": string
}
Trường
startDate

string

Ngày bắt đầu ở định dạng YYYY-MM-DD.

endDate

string

Ngày kết thúc ở định dạng YYYY-MM-DD.